What are Catering Proposal Templates?

Catering proposal templates are pre-designed documents used by catering businesses to outline their services, pricing, menus, and event logistics for potential clients.

These templates provide a structured format for presenting key information, such as event details, catering menu options, dietary restrictions, staffing requirements, equipment rentals, payment terms, and contact information.

Most catering menu proposal templates are customizable, often based on the type of event (such as weddings, corporate events, or private parties), and are shared in editable formats like Word or PDF.

What Makes a Good Catering Proposal Template?

A good catering proposal template should be both functional and professional to help you have satisfied clients. It makes sure you present all the necessary details clearly and efficiently.

Here are the key elements that make a catering proposal template effective:

  • Clarity: Select a catering proposal template that is easy to read and free from unnecessary complexity
  • Comprehensive: Choose a catering proposal template covering all essential details like menu options, pricing, and event logistics
  • Customizable: Pick a free template for catering that is flexible enough to adapt to different event types and client needs
  • Visually appealing: Go for catering proposal templates with organized layouts that exude professionalism
  • Consistent branding: Prioritize a catering proposal template that aligns with your company’s design and tone for a cohesive look
